The King in Yellow — Page 5
I told him, smiling, that I would get even with him for his mistake, and he laughed heartily, and asked me to call once in a while.
나는 미소를 지으며 그의 실수에 대해 반드시 복수하겠다고 말했고, 그는 크게 웃으며 가끔 들러 달라고 부탁했다.
I did so, hoping for a chance to even up accounts, but he gave me none, and I told him I would wait.
나는 그렇게 했고, 빚을 갚을 기회를 바랐지만, 그는 내게 그런 기회를 주지 않았고, 나는 기다리겠다고 말했다.
The fall from my horse had fortunately left no evil results; on the contrary it had changed my whole character for the better.
말에서 떨어진 것은 다행히도 나쁜 결과를 남기지 않았고, 오히려 내 성격 전체를 더 좋은 방향으로 바꾸어 놓았다.
From a lazy young man about town, I had become active, energetic, temperate, and above all—oh, above all else—ambitious.
도시를 빈둥거리며 돌아다니던 게으른 청년에서, 나는 활동적이고 활기차며 절제 있고, 무엇보다도—아, 무엇보다도—야심 찬 사람이 되었다.
There was only one thing which troubled me, I laughed at my own uneasiness, and yet it troubled me.
나를 괴롭히는 것이 딱 한 가지 있었는데, 나는 내 자신의 불안감을 비웃었지만, 그럼에도 그것은 나를 괴롭혔다.
During my convalescence I had bought and read for the first time, The King in Yellow.
회복기 동안 나는 처음으로 《황색 왕》을 사서 읽었다.
I remember after finishing the first act that it occurred to me that I had better stop.
나는 1막을 다 읽고 난 후 그만 읽는 편이 낫겠다는 생각이 들었던 것을 기억한다.
I started up and flung the book into the fireplace; the volume struck the barred grate and fell open on the hearth in the firelight.
나는 벌떡 일어나 책을 벽난로 속으로 내던졌다. 그 책은 쇠창살에 부딪혀 불빛이 타오르는 난로 바닥 위에 펼쳐진 채 떨어졌다.
